Not sure if this is the right forum, but I have Office 365 and have started to use the OneDrive facility. I have synched my photos to OneDrive, but would like to Sync some specific folders also. There does not seem to be the option to do that - if I go into Manage Backups, I just get the option to Sync Desktop, Documents and Pictures. Can't seem to specify just a few folders under Documents. There are somethings I do not want to Sync to OneDrive.


I know I can copy folders to OneDrive manually, not quite as useful.
